The risk of global weather connections

This report analyses the links between extreme weather events occurring in separate regions of the world that can take place over a range of timescales from days to years (known as teleconnections).

It is an insurer’s responsibility to assess that levels of capital are adequate for all material risks and demonstrate that to the regulators. Many use internal models to show this is the case. For assessment of teleconnections, these internal models are based predominantly on the assumption that extreme weather events in different regions occur independently of each other.

Lloyd’s worked with the Met Office to develop this innovative study, which for the first time analyses the potential links between weather events globally; existing methodologies cover single regions only. This allows reinsurers to use the report to model scenarios across their global portfolios.
